Klyties Developments Inc. is the subject of insolvency proceedings in Alberta, commenced on October 1, 2007 on the application of Douglas Landsberg, Yoav Sagi, Ilan Hadar, Uri Maor and Zvi Shainfeld. Ernst & Young Inc. is the appointed officer. The matter, under court file number 0701-08328, remains active.

Claims processIf you are owed money

A claims procedure has been established — see the order for deadlines.

Per the Claim Process Order dated 29 April 2008.

The officer filed report no. Fourth Report of the Receiver. The Receiver is winding down the Klytie's receivership by realizing remaining U.S. real property (notably the Fredricksburg, Texas parcel), finalizing the claims process, and proposing an interim distribution to investors and creditors, with a final distribution and discharge to follow once the remaining property sale closes.

Source: Fourth Report of the Receiver
